About The Role

Job Summary

We are seeking a skilled and motivated Mainframe Developer with 5 to 6 years of hands-on experience in developing, maintaining, and supporting enterprise mainframe applications. The ideal candidate should have strong expertise in COBOL, DB2, JCL, and VSAM , with a solid understanding of mainframe development life cycles, production support, and troubleshooting. Exposure to IMS DB/DC is highly desirable and will be considered an added advantage.

Key Responsibilities

  • Analyze business requirements and translate them into technical design and development solutions.
  • Develop, enhance, test, and maintain mainframe applications using COBOL, DB2, JCL, and VSAM .
  • Design and develop efficient DB2 SQL queries, stored procedures, and database access modules .
  • Create and modify batch jobs, job streams, and utilities using JCL .
  • Develop and maintain VSAM files , file processing programs, and data conversion utilities.
  • Perform unit testing, integration testing, and support User Acceptance Testing (UAT).
  • Investigate and resolve production issues, including performance tuning and root cause analysis.
  • Participate in code reviews and ensure adherence to coding standards and best practices.
  • Prepare technical documentation, program specifications, and operational procedures.
  • Support application modernization and transformation initiatives where applicable.

Required Technical Skills

Mandatory Skills

  • Strong hands-on experience in:
  • COBOL
  • DB2
  • JCL
  • VSAM
  • Experience in developing and supporting batch and online mainframe applications.
  • Proficiency in DB2 SQL programming , query optimization, and database design concepts.
  • Good understanding of file processing, debugging, and performance tuning.
  • Experience with Endevor, Changeman, ISPW , or similar source control/version management tools.
  • Knowledge of Mainframe Utilities such as SORT, IDCAMS, IEBGENER, and DFSORT.
  • Experience in production support and incident management.

Good to Have

  • Exposure to IMS DB and/or IMS DC .
  • Experience with CICS development .
  • Knowledge of MQ Series integration.
  • Exposure to Agile/Scrum methodologies.

Familiarity with mainframe modernization or cloud integration initiatives
